Output 3443686c5933049d8ae18fc588fa3178418f17b2a918f7752eaa37c57fe3c2fb:2

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f82044ece9774e9262d84237b828ae13851132 OP_EQUAL
address
3QJA52UKiWA9gnHvjCeBM29t5pxi5zPGJY
transaction
3443686c5933049d8ae18fc588fa3178418f17b2a918f7752eaa37c57fe3c2fb
spent
true